Graduate Assistantship Program

Oxford Physical Therapy Centers is involved with post-graduate education by sponsoring the Oxford Physical Therapy Centers Graduate Assistantship Program. This program continues the education of the qualified certified athletic trainer in Post-Baccalaureate study. The student assistantship supports the activities in a number of settings.

The student will work with clinicians in an outpatient physical therapy setting to enhance clinical patient care skills, as well as assist and support the evaluation, treatment, rehabilitation, and functional progression of athletes in a local high school. The student will earn a Masters of Science degree in Exercise and Health Studies from Miami University.

The emphasis of the program is to enhance the skills of a certified athletic trainer by furthering their education and facilitating the responsibilities of evaluation, treatment, and rehabilitation. This is accomplished in party by following the Mission of Oxford Physical Therapy Centers and to demonstrate the commitment to education and advancing the profession.
